Fishing only allowed Dawn till Dusk.
Night Time fishing only by prior arrangement, with relevant permit.
3 Last person must shut and lock the gate on leaving the trust.
All landing nets must be dipped in the Dip Tanks before being used for at least 15 minutes prior to fishing. We have a healthy fish stock we aim to keep it that way.
No Artificial Baits e.g., plastic bread, maggots, corn, etc. All Cat or Dog Meat Baits are banned. No Tiger Nuts No Aniseed No Bloodworm No Joker No live Baiting
Only Disabled Badge Holders trustees & OAP's (with official trust pass) can keep their cars at the swims but able-bodied anglers can unload their cars and return them to the car park. All relative badges must be displayed.
Unhooking Mats to be used with bigger fish at all times and must be dipped prior to fishing at all times.
Max 2 RODS to be used.
Every angler must have an Environment Agency Rod License according to law appropriate to the amount of rods being used before starting to fish.
All anglers and visitors must uphold a good standard of conduct whilst at the Manderson Trust Lakes.
No barbed hooks, hooks libel to inspection by any bailiff or trustee.
Please take all rubbish home or put it in the bins provided and not discarded at the trust.
No rods to be left unattended at any time. (i.e. no more than one swim away.)
Ground bait to be used in moderation. All surplus ground bait to be taken home and not discarded on site.
All fish to be handled carefully and returned to the water ASAP.
No fires or damage to wildlife or trust property.
No children under 16 unless accompanied by an adult at the trust lakes. (Adult being 18 or over.)
No Dogs at any time except guide dogs or by prior arrangement.
No keep nets allowed at the trust except on matches arranged by the trust.
No Digging of bank side, you must use swims provided.
All Alcohol is prohibited at all times.
Braid is allowed for hook link only but not as a main line.
